Loading…
Cephalocon 2019 has ended
Barcelona, Spain
May 19-20, 2019
Click Here for More Information & Registration
Back To Schedule
Sunday, May 19 • 11:50 - 12:30
Object Bucket Provisioning in Rook-Ceph - Jonathan Cope & Jeff Vance, Red Hat

Sign up or log in to save this to your schedule, view media, leave feedback and see who's attending!

While Kubernetes internally supports a generalized API for managing file and block storage, S3 object storage is fundamentally lacking. Rook, a cloud native storage orchestrator, has brought several S3 object storage providers into the Kubernetes ecosystem, including Ceph-Object. What Rook lacks is a generalized Kubernetes S3 API for bucket provisioning. We are designing and implementing such an operator for Rook. This operator provides a generalized S3 bucket provisioning API for Kubernetes users via a set of Custom Resource Definitions. Through these CRDs, Ceph-Object consumers can utilize Kubernetes to provision and manage their Ceph-Object buckets. This presentation focuses on the design goals and use-cases for native Rook bucket provisioning, and some bucket CRD implementation details.

Speakers
JC

Jonathan Cope

Software Engineer, Red Hat
Jon is a Senior Software Engineer at Red Hat, working remotely from Austin, Tx. He has been a contributor to Kubernetes since 2016, focusing primarily on Kubernetes storage and storage-proximal projects. His work with object storage in Kubernetes includes the co-development of a provisioner... Read More →
JV

Jeff Vance

senior developer, Red Hat
Jeff has been working at Red Hat for 7 years and lives and works in Santa Cruz, Ca. He is a senior developer focusing on Kubernetes and Openshift storage. He is currently involved with various object stores and incorporating them into both Kubernetes and Rook-Ceph.



Sunday May 19, 2019 11:50 - 12:30 BST
G1